惊艳!GitHub 开发者一键接入!4.2k star 项目 Champ,用一张照片秒变动画

简介: “Champ” 致力于从一张静态人物图生成流畅连续的人体动画,支撑精准姿态控制与形状一致性,其核心思路是将 3D 参数化人体模型(SMPL)引入扩散模型:

嗨,我是小华同学,专注解锁高效工作与前沿AI工具!每日精选开源技术、实战技巧,助你省时50%、领先他人一步。👉免费订阅,与10万+技术人共享升级秘籍!


“Champ” 致力于从一张静态人物图生成流畅连续的人体动画,支撑精准姿态控制与形状一致性,其核心思路是将 3D 参数化人体模型(SMPL)引入扩散模型:

  • 使用 SMPL 提供的人体深度图、法线图、语义图及骨架,引导基于潜变量的扩散过程;
  • 通过多层运动融合模块融合形状与动作,提升动画质量与稳定性;
  • 可复用任意参照图及任意驱动视频,实现跨身份动画生成。

痛点场景

静态人物图如何“活”起来?传统动画:

  • 动画效果不真实:细节把控差;
  • 对齐失败:目标图与动作难协同;
  • 姿势跳帧明显:动画不连续流畅。

Champ 正是为解决这些痛点而生,实现:

  • 形状一致:保持人物体型、服饰等视觉统一;
  • 动作精细:捕捉骨骼动态的流畅变化;
  • 跨身份驱动:一张图带动任意动作视频。

核心功能

  • SMPL 参数化指导:不仅仅是二维骨骼,而是深入 3D 参数驱动,多图条件融合。
  • 多层运动融合模块:使用自注意力模块,在扩散潜空间对动作与形状同时进行融合。
  • 三通道深度条件输入:融合深度图、法线图与语义图,让生成过程更具空间结构意识。
  • 跨身份动画:支持给 A 人图像但使用 B 视频驱动,实现动画“换脸”无缝衔接。
  • 较强泛化能力:在 Wild 数据集、TikTok 常用视频表现稳定。
  • 开源实用性强:提供完整代码、预训练模型与 inference 脚本,即装即用。
  • Blender 渲染支持:后处理支持 Blender,使用户能导出真实动画视频。

技术架构与优势

image.png

技术优势总结表

功能模块 优势
SMPL 参数化引导 相比传统控制骨骼,可提供三维形状与动作对齐
多通道条件融合 语义图+深度+法线多模态信息齐全
自注意力运动模块 跨帧融合减少伪影,提升流畅性
开源底层基于潜变量扩散 推理速度快,可控性高

界面及效果展示

项目 README 中提供的界面与结果十分直观,例如:

  • Blender 渲染脚本导出:用户反馈“用最少帧就能跑起来”“Motion 模块流程技术太强”;
  • SMPL 渲染效果图:可视化骨骼和深度供生成网络使用;
  • 预训练模型调用示例:只需 python inference.py --config configs/inference.yaml 即可快速生成结果。

应用场景

Champ 在以下领域有极高应用价值:

  1. 虚拟主播/形象动画:一张图配任意动作;
  2. 短视频创作:轻松实现人物动画;
  3. 游戏中人物动作生成:强化表现力场景;
  4. 电影后期:替身动画、姿态调整;
  5. 教育动画制作:体育科教中人体动态演示。

项目优势

项目名称 主要技术 优势 劣势
MagicAnimate 骨骼2D控制扩散 使用简单 动作不稳定、形状变化大
AnimateDiff 文本/视频驱动扩散 文本可控 无形状约束
Champ SMPL+扩散 三维形状统一 + 多模态融合 + 跨身份驱动 需装 Blender,显存要求高

Champ 的主要优势在于加入人体 3D 参数形态,通过图+潜空间深度控制,动画稳定一致,远超骨骼或文本版本的泛化能力。尤其适合对一致性与精准度要求较高的生产场景。

总结

Champ 在人体动画领域迈出重要一步:3D 模型+潜变量扩散结合,多条件融合生成可控、高质量动画。从趣味创作到专业级应用都具备潜力,社区技术反馈热烈,生态日渐完善。

项目地址

https://github.com/fudan-generative-vision/champ

相关文章
|
7月前
|
Apache 数据安全/隐私保护 Docker
【开源问答系统】GitHub 14.9k star 的开源问答引擎来了,三分钟搭建完成~~~
Apache Answer 是一款开源问答系统,助力团队将零散知识沉淀为结构化资产。支持 Docker 快速部署、插件扩展、权限控制与多语言,兼具高效搜索、投票排序与私有化部署能力,适用于技术社区、企业知识库与用户支持场景。
909 22
|
7月前
|
人工智能 JavaScript 前端开发
Github 2024-10-28 开源项目周报 Top15
本周GitHub热门项目涵盖Svelte、Open Interpreter、PowerShell等,涉及Web开发、AI助手、自动化工具等领域,Python、JavaScript为主流语言,展现开源技术活跃生态。(239字)
728 19
|
7月前
|
人工智能 JavaScript 前端开发
Github 2024-11-04 开源项目周报 Top14
本周GitHub热门项目涵盖屏幕截图转代码、网页监控、低代码开发等。Python与TypeScript主导,亮点项目包括AI生成代码工具、开源社交应用Bluesky及机器人框架LeRobot,展现AI与自动化技术的快速发展趋势。
415 15
|
7月前
|
人工智能 JavaScript Docker
Github 2024-11-11 开源项目周报 Top15
本周GitHub热门项目涵盖多领域:Python与TypeScript领跑,包括屏幕截图转代码、本地文件共享、PDF处理、AI开发代理等。亮点项目如screenshot-to-code、LocalSend、OpenHands及Diagrams,兼具创新与实用性,广受开发者关注。
871 13
|
7月前
|
人工智能 算法 JavaScript
Github 2024-10-14 开源项目周报 Top14
本周GitHub热门项目共14个,Python项目占7席。涵盖算法实现、生成式AI、金融分析、目标检测等领域,包括TheAlgorithms系列、OpenBB金融平台、Ultralytics YOLO11、Manim动画框架等,展现开源技术多元发展态势。
286 8
|
7月前
|
人工智能 Rust JavaScript
Github 2024-10-07 开源项目周报 Top15
本周GitHub热门项目共15个,Python项目占比最高达7个。榜首为Python算法实现集合TheAlgorithms/Python,Star数超17万;其他亮点包括Godot游戏引擎、OpenBB金融平台、ToolJet低代码框架及新兴AI相关项目如Crawl4AI、Llama Stack等,涵盖游戏、金融、AI、理财等多个领域。
322 4
|
7月前
|
人工智能 Rust 算法
Github 2024-09-30 开源项目周报 Top15
本周GitHub热门项目揭晓:Python主导,AutoGPT居首,涵盖AI、编程、数学动画等领域,助力开发者探索前沿技术。
289 4
|
7月前
|
人工智能 JavaScript 前端开发
Github 2024-09-16 开源项目周报 Top14
本周GitHub热门项目涵盖Python、TypeScript、Go等语言,React居首。亮点包括微软PowerToys、Node版本管理器、AI证件照工具HivisionIDPhotos及端侧大模型MiniCPM等。
272 2
|
7月前
|
Rust JavaScript 安全
Github 2024-09-02 开源项目周报 Top13
本周GitHub热门项目涵盖AI、开发工具与开源替代品。包括Notion替代AppFlowy、Airtable替代NocoDB、云平台Coolify及可观察性平台OpenObserve等,涉及Python、TypeScript、Rust等语言,聚焦效率、隐私与自动化。
432 1
|
8月前
|
缓存 自然语言处理 JavaScript
Github 3k+ star,中后台管理系统框架,支持多款 UI 组件库,兼容PC、移动端!比商业系统还专业!!
Fantastic-admin/basic 是基于 Vue3 与 TypeScript 的中后台管理系统框架,支持多款 UI 组件库,如 Element Plus、Arco Design、Naive-UI 等。它提供完整的项目结构、权限控制、国际化、多级缓存标签页等功能,兼容 PC、平板及移动端,适合快速搭建企业级后台应用。框架具备高度可定制性,拥有 3k+ GitHub Star,生态完善,适合中小团队和个人开发者提升效率。
525 2

热门文章

最新文章

下一篇
开通oss服务